What this inspection record means

OSHA opens inspections for many reasons — routine scheduling under a national or local emphasis program, an employee complaint or referral, or a follow-up after a reported injury. Opening or conducting an inspection is not itself an allegation or a finding that this employer broke any rule; any findings appear as the citations listed below, and citations can be contested, reduced, or withdrawn.

29 CFR 1926.602(c)(1)(ii):  Modifications or additions affecting the safe operation of the equipment were made without the manufacturer's written approval:  Note:  If such modifications or changes were made, the capacity, operation, and maintenance instruction plates, tags, or decals should have been changed accordingly.  At the residential construction site located at 300 SE Little Garden Lane, Blue Springs, Missouri:  Employees were exposed to fall hazards when working from a wooden box attached to the forks of a JLG Sky Trak Telehandler.  Modifications and additions were performed without manufacturers prior written approval as required.

29 CFR 1926.501(b)(13):  Each employee(s) engaged in residential construction activities 6 feet (1.8 m) or more above lower levels were not protected by guardrail systems, safety net system, or personal fall arrest system, nor were employee(s) provided with an alternative fall protection measure under another provision of paragraph 1926.501 (b):   At the residential construction site located directly west of 300 SE Little Garden Lane, Blue Springs, Missouri:  Employees were exposed to fall hazards when installing siding on a new residential structure without the use of a fall protection system.

29 CFR 1926.1053(b)(4):  Ladders were used for purposes other than the purposes for which they were designed:  At the residential construction site located at 300 SE Little Garden Lane, Blue Springs, Missouri:  Employees were exposed to fall hazards associated with improper use of a step ladder on a construction site.    1.  Employees were working from a portable eight-foot A-frame step ladder in the closed position.    2.  Employees were working from a portable ten-foot A-frame step ladder in the closed position.
